#doc-news{}

.content-news{width:300px;float:right;line-height: 1.0em;border:1px solid #bbb;background:#f9f9f9;margin:10px;padding-bottom:5px;}
.content-news h4{font-size:1.0em;color:#fff;background:#e43424;padding-bottom:3px;font-style: normal;border:none;padding-left:10px;padding-top:2px;padding-bottom:2px;}

.image_right {float:right;width:290px;margin-left:5px;margin-bottom:5px;}
.image_rightsmall {float:right;width:85px;margin-left:5px;margin-bottom:5px;}

.newsitem{font-size:10px;float:left;width:280px;padding:0px;height:120px;}
.newsitem p {color:#000;}
.newsitem-date {color:#666;}
.newsitem h2{font-size:1.0em;color:#e43424;padding-bottom:3px;font-style: normal;border:none;}
.newsitem a{color:#ff8200;text-decoration:none;}
.newsitem a:hover{color:#f00;}








.newscontain{float:left;overflow:hidden}
.newsdate {float: left;margin-bottom: -2000px; padding-bottom: 2000px;}
.newsdate{width:70px;margin-right:20px;}

.newscontain table{font-size:1.3em;}
.newscontain table td{text-align:center;padding:6px;}

.newsitem-dark{font-size:1.3em;color:#fff;background-color:#7c7d7f;text-align:center;}
.newsitem-highlight{font-size:0.7em;color:#fff;background-color:#e83625;text-align:center;}

#news_carousel{float:left;width:280px;margin-left:8px;margin-right:8px;margin-top:5px;}

.carouselbutton{}
#mycarousel-next{font-size:10px;color:#505195;text-decoration:none;}
#mycarousel-prev{font-size:10px;color:#505195;text-decoration:none;margin-right:30px;padding-left:10px;}
#mycarousel-next:hover{color:#e43424;}
#mycarousel-prev:hover{color:#e43424;}

